Cara Hales murder trial told Jesse de Beaux saw ‘sign from god’ before Munster killing

Published

on


A man who smashed his way into a Perth house and fatally stabbed a woman was in a psychotic state at the time and believed he was “being controlled by a god”, WA’s Supreme Court has been told.

Jesse John de Beaux, 25 is on trial accused of the murder of 30-year-old Cara Hales, who was stabbed dozens of times in the bedroom of her Munster home three days after Christmas in 2018.
